[PATCH 6/8] target: Issue Power-On/Reset UA upon LUN instantiation

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Whenever a LUN is being assigned we should be sending out an
Power-On/Reset UA.

 drivers/target/target_core_device.c | 16 ++++++++++------
 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/target/target_core_device.c b/drivers/target/target_core_device.c
index 52676a0..88d6070 100644
--- a/drivers/target/target_core_device.c
+++ b/drivers/target/target_core_device.c
@@ -363,9 +363,11 @@ int core_enable_device_list_for_node(
 		rcu_read_lock();
 		hlist_for_each_entry_rcu(tmp, &nacl->lun_entry_hlist, link) {
 			if (tmp == new)
-				continue;
-			core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x3F,
-				ASCQ_3FH_REPORTED_LUNS_DATA_HAS_CHANGED);
+				core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x29,
+					ASCQ_29H_POWER_ON_RESET_OR_BUS_DEVICE_RESET_OCCURED);
+			else
+				core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x3F,
+					ASCQ_3FH_REPORTED_LUNS_DATA_HAS_CHANGED);
 		}
 		rcu_read_unlock();
 
@@ -385,9 +387,11 @@ int core_enable_device_list_for_node(
 	rcu_read_lock();
 	hlist_for_each_entry_rcu(tmp, &nacl->lun_entry_hlist, link) {
 		if (tmp == new)
-			continue;
-		core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x3F,
-			ASCQ_3FH_REPORTED_LUNS_DATA_HAS_CHANGED);
+			core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x29,
+				ASCQ_29H_POWER_ON_RESET_OR_BUS_DEVICE_RESET_OCCURED);
+		else
+			core_scsi3_ua_allocate(tmp, 0x3F,
+				ASCQ_3FH_REPORTED_LUNS_DATA_HAS_CHANGED);
 	}
 	rcu_read_unlock();
 	return 0;
